Photography - Mumbai, Maharashtra, India
Taj Foto Studio - India is a photography company based out of 16 Shop No. 1 Plot No 12 Grace Heritage, Road No, Mumbai, Maharashtra, India.
Nginx
WordPress.org
Google Tag Manager
Google AdSense
YouTube
Google Analytics